Friday, March 27, 2009

Frank took Natalia's hands and told him that he knew it was right they were together because she fit in so well with his family. He then asked what type of wedding she wanted and suggested some ideas, like having it in his or her backyard. Soon, Olivia joined them. Frank officially got down on one knee and proposed to Nat, who accepted. "You can get up now," Liv told him. "Do I have to?" he joked. Liv did her best to look happy for them. After, they returned to the kitchen where Olivia raised a toast to the couple. Frank promised to make Natalia happy; Liv turned away when they shared a quick kiss. She then said she needed to leave because she had things to do. Natalia was eager to tell his family the good news.

Marina got a letter saying that she got Company back. After she joined Daisy, Mallet and Buzz at home, who were all cooing over baby Henry. Daisy informed Marina that they were going to the courthouse to watch Phillip fry. Marina asked if they could move past their issues with the Spauldings and start focusing on their family instead. Daisy agreed ... after they watched Phillip get his.

A frantic Lizzie asked if Phillip did something to Grady. Phillip explained that he didn't have a choice because he had to keep Lizzie safe. Lizzie was horrified. "You are just like Granddad," she told him. "I don't want to be a part of it. I don't want to know that someone is dead because of me." Phillip assured her that she had nothing to do with his actions. "This was my choice, not yours!" he stated. Lizzie thought he should've brought in the police, but Phillip noted that it would've been her word against Grady's. "I just grabbed him ... and he was gone," Phillip recalled. "I threw him over the cliff. God help me, I killed him ... and I'd do it again." He then declared his love for his daughter, but Lizzie admitted that she didn't feel safe with him. "You kidnap people, you murder people, that is not love," she argued. "How can it be love when it makes you do such awful things?" "It's love; it's overwhelming," he replied. He left when Bill joined Lizzie. Bill asked what Phillip said to her. "He just told me he loved me," she said quietly. Lizzie then told Bill that her dad "took care" of Grady for her. She wished she could be away from her family. Bill pointed out that her family made her who she is. "They love you in their own freakish way," he noted. "We don't have to let loving them take away from what we have." Bill urged her to go to the courthouse.

Frank and Nat stopped by Mallet and Marina's place and revealed they they were engaged. M&M were thrilled. Marina offered to help with all of the wedding details. Frank wanted Natalia to have the wedding of her dreams. "Nicely done, Dad," Marina said when she got a look at the ring.... Olivia got drunk with Edmund and Shane. After ordering in pizza, they created their own little rock band with Liv playing drums and the guys singing and playing guitar (or trying to play, in this case). Liv thanked them for the fun time.

At the courthouse, Beth met up with Phillip. She thought he needed a real attorney rather than her. Soon, the hearing began. Buzz read a letter from Harley saying that she was glad her kids were out of the country with Phillip in town.... Beth took the stand and Doris questioned her about Beth and Phillip's relationship. Beth admitted that she's been afraid of him. Beth then acted as Phillip's lawyer and called Emma to the stand. Phillip didn't want her at the trial, but Emma insisted on being there. On the stand, Beth asked how Emma felt about Phillip "He's my Daddy. I love him," she said. Doris then questioned the little girl and Emma said that she was afraid she'd lose Phillip again. Beth said they had no other witnesses; Doris called Alan for the prosecution's side. Alan stated that he believed Phillip was dangerous and had recently displayed some erratic behavior. Lizzie then asked if she could take the stand. She said that Phillip was really trying to protect her, even if he went about it in the wrong way. She explained that while she couldn't really forgive him, she believed that he loves her. "I want him to learn how to love that much without letting his emotions conquer him," she finished. Later, Phillip asked Beth if he could have a few minutes by himself to clear his head.

Marina invited her family to Company. There, Frank informed a thrilled Buzz of his engagement. Marina then joined them and announced that she is now the owner. "Our family needs to own this restaurant. This is who we are," she stated. "I think it's wonderful," Nat told her. The rest agreed and celebrated the good news.... Olivia stopped by and sadly peered in the window at Natalia fitting in so well with the Coopers.

Phillip left the courthouse and spied Lizzie snuggling with Bill. The scene made him smile.
